body{margin:0;padding:0;background-color:#DAE2E4;background-color:#002844;font-family:"Roboto", sans-serif;font-size:12px;color:#222;}div.clear{clear:both;}input:focus,select:focus,textarea:focus{outline:none !important;}div.top{display:block;width:100%;background-color:#00406E;overflow:hidden;margin:0 auto 0 auto;height:58px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;-webkit-box-shadow:0 0 5px 3px rgba(0,0,0,0.2);-moz-box-shadow:0 0 5px 3px rgba(0,0,0,0.2);box-shadow:0 0 5px 3px rgba(0,0,0,0.2);}div.top > div.inner{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:calc(100% - 20px);max-width:960px;height:58px;margin:0 auto 0 auto;}div.top > div.inner > p{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:160px;height:34px;}div.top > div.inner > p > a{display:block;overflow:hidden;width:160px;height:32px;background-image:url("/graphics/logo_white.svg");background-repeat:no-repeat;background-size:32px 32px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;cursor:pointer;text-decoration:none;color:#333;font-size:19px;font-weight:300;line-height:32px;}div.top > div.inner > p > a > span{margin-left:38px;font-weight:700;color:#FFF;}@media screen and (max-width:379px){}div.front{display:block;width:100%;background-color:#FFF;overflow:hidden;margin:0 auto 0 auto;height:500px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;background-image:-webkit-linear-gradient(left, #8cd8f2 0, #8cd8f2 50%, #06253B 50%, #06253B 100%);background-image:-moz-linear-gradient(left, #8cd8f2 0, #8cd8f2 50%, #06253B 50%, #06253B 100%);background-image:-o-linear-gradient(left, #8cd8f2 0, #8cd8f2 50%, #06253B 50%, #06253B 100%);background-image:-ms-linear-gradient(left, #8cd8f2 0, #8cd8f2 50%, #06253B 50%, #06253B 100%);background-image:linear-gradient(left, #8cd8f2 0, #8cd8f2 50%, #06253B 50%, #06253B 100%);}div.front > div.inner{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:calc(100% - 20px);max-width:1260px;height:500px;margin:0 auto 0 auto;background-image:url("/graphics/landinghead.jpg");background-repeat:no-repeat;background-position:top right -50px;background-size:auto 500px;}div.front > div.inner > p{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;font-size:21px;line-height:30px;font-weight:300;margin:0;padding:0;color:rgba(0,0,0,0.7);}div.front > div.inner > p:nth-child(1){margin:140px 650px 20px 150px;}div.front > div.inner > p:nth-child(2){margin:50px 650px 20px 150px;}div.front > div.inner > p > strong{font-weight:700;color:#06253B;}@media screen and (max-width:1259px){div.front{}div.front > div.inner{width:960px;background-position:top right -50px;}div.front > div.inner > p:nth-child(1){margin:100px 650px 0 0;}div.front > div.inner > p:nth-child(2){margin:50px 650px 20px 0;}}@media screen and (max-width:1099px){div.front{height:400px;}div.front > div.inner{background-size:auto 400px;background-position:top right -50px;max-width:960px;width:calc(100% - 40px);}div.front > div.inner > p:nth-child(1){margin:50px 530px 0 20px;}div.front > div.inner > p:nth-child(2){margin:30px 530px 20px 20px;}}@media screen and (max-width:899px){div.front{height:300px;background-image:none;background-color:#8cd8f2;}div.front > div.inner{background-size:auto 300px;width:100%;background-position:top right -150px;}div.front > div.inner > p:nth-child(1){margin:50px 280px 0 50px;font-size:17px;line-height:25px;font-weight:300;}div.front > div.inner > p:nth-child(2){margin:30px 280px 20px 50px;font-size:17px;line-height:25px;font-weight:300;}}@media screen and (max-width:699px){div.front{height:200px;background-image:none;background-color:#8cd8f2;}div.front > div.inner{background-size:auto 200px;width:100%;background-position:top right -150px;}div.front > div.inner > p:nth-child(1){margin:30px 150px 0 40px;line-height:21px;}div.front > div.inner > p:nth-child(2){margin:20px 150px 20px 40px;line-height:21px;}}@media screen and (max-width:599px){div.front > div.inner > p:nth-child(1){margin:45px 180px 0 50px;line-height:23px;font-size:17px;font-weight:300;}div.front > div.inner > p:nth-child(2){display:none;}}@media screen and (max-width:499px){div.front > div.inner > p:nth-child(1){margin:40px 140px 0 50px;line-height:21px;font-size:15px;font-weight:300;}div.front > div.inner > p:nth-child(2){display:none;}}@media screen and (max-width:399px){div.front{height:300px;}div.front > div.inner{height:300px;background-size:auto 300px;background-position:top right -290px;}div.front > div.inner > p:nth-child(1){margin:40px 150px 0 50px;line-height:21px;font-size:15px;font-weight:300;}div.front > div.inner > p:nth-child(2){display:none;}}@media screen and (max-width:299px){div.front{height:280px;}div.front > div.inner{height:280px;background-size:auto 280px;background-position:top right -120px;}div.front > div.inner > p:nth-child(1){display:none;}div.front > div.inner > p:nth-child(2){display:none;}}div.contact{display:block;overflow:hidden;width:100%;background-color:#002844;overflow:hidden;margin:0 auto 0 auto;height:auto;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;}div.contact > div.inner{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:calc(100% - 20px);max-width:960px;height:auto;margin:0 auto 0 auto;}div.contact > div.inner > div.column{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:calc(50% - 20px);float:left;margin:0 40px 0 0;padding:50px 0 0 0;}div.contact > div.inner > div.column:nth-child(2){margin-right:0;}div.contact > div.inner > div.column:nth-child(1) > p{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;color:#FFF;color:rgba(255,255,255,0.8);margin:0 10px 20px 0;font-size:15px;line-height:21px;font-weight:300;}div.contact > div.inner > div.column:nth-child(1) > p > strong{color:#FFF;font-weight:700;}div.contact > div.inner > div.column:nth-child(1) > ul{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;list-style:none;margin:0 0 20px 0;padding:0;}div.contact > div.inner > div.column:nth-child(1) > ul > li{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;border-style:solid;border-color:rgba(255,255,255,0.1);border-width:0 0 1px 0;}div.contact > div.inner > div.column:nth-child(1) > ul > li:last-child{border-width:0;}div.contact > div.inner > div.column:nth-child(1) > ul > li > div{color:#FFF;width:calc(50% - 10px);float:left;margin:5px 10px 5px 0;font-size:15px;line-height:21px;font-weight:300;}div.contact > div.inner > div.column:nth-child(1) > ul > li > div:nth-child(2){width:calc(50%);margin-right:0;text-align:right;}div.contact > div.inner > div.column:nth-child(1) > ul > li > div:nth-child(2) > a{color:#FFF;text-decoration:none;}div.contact > div.inner > div.column:nth-child(2) > div.form{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;background-color:rgba(0,0,0,0.2);-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;margin:0 0 20px 0;}div.contact > div.inner > div.column:nth-child(2) > div.form > p{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;padding:40px 0 40px 0;font-size:17px;line-heigth:27px;color:rgba(255,255,255,0.7);font-weight:300;width:calc(100% - 80px);margin:0 auto 0 auto;text-align:center;}div.contact > div.inner > div.column:nth-child(2) > div.form > form{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;padding:40px 0 40px 0;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.error{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in:0 auto 20px auto;width:calc(100% - 80px);}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.error:empty{display:none;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.error > p{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;margin:0;padding:0;color:#F00;font-size:13px;line-height:19px;font-weight:700;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.field{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:calc(100% - 80px);margin:0 auto 20px auto;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.field > label{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;color:#FFF;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.field > input,div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.field > textarea{display:block;background-color:#FFF;background-color:rgba(255,255,255,0.1);border-style:solid;border-color:rgba(255,255,255,0.2);border-width:1px;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;margin:0;width:100%;font-family:"Roboto", sans-serif;font-size:12px;line-height:20px;padding:5px;height:32px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;-webkit-appearance:none;-moz-appearance:none;appearance:none;filter:none;color:#FFF;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.field > textarea{resize:none;height:80px;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.buttons{display:block;overflow:hidden;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:calc(100% - 80px);margin:0 auto 0 auto;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.buttons > input{display:block;border-style:solid;border-color:#CCC;border-width:1px;font-weight:bold;background-color:#555;background-image:-webkit-linear-gradient(top, #FFF 0,#EEE 100%);background-image:-moz-linear-gradient(top, #FFF 0,#EEE 100%);background-image:-o-linear-gradient(top, #FFF 0,#EEE 100%);background-image:-ms-linear-gradient(top, #FFF 0,#EEE 100%);background-image:linear-gradient(top, #FFF 0,#EEE 100%);background-size:auto;background-repeat:repeat;background-position:top center;font-family:"Roboto", sans-serif;font-weight:500;font-size:12px;color:#444;text-decoration:none;padding:7px 15px 7px 15px;width:auto;float:left;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;-webkit-border-radius:4px;-moz-border-radius:4px;border-radius:4px;margin:0 10px 0 0;cursor:pointer;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.buttons > input:hover{background-image:-webkit-linear-gradient(top, #FFF 0,#FFF 100%);background-image:-moz-linear-gradient(top, #FFF 0,#FFF 100%);background-image:-o-linear-gradient(top, #FFF 0,#FFF 100%);background-image:-ms-linear-gradient(top, #FFF 0,#FFF 100%);background-image:linear-gradient(top, #FFF 0,#FFF 100%);}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.buttons > input:active{background-image:-webkit-linear-gradient(top, #EEE 0,#EEE 100%);background-image:-moz-linear-gradient(top, #EEE 0,#EEE 100%);background-image:-o-linear-gradient(top, #EEE 0,#EEE 100%);background-image:-ms-linear-gradient(top, #EEE 0,#EEE 100%);background-image:linear-gradient(top, #EEE 0,#EEE 100%);}div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.buttons > input[disabled="disabled"],div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.buttons > input[disabled="disabled"]:hover,div.contact > div.inner > div.column:nth-child(2) > div.form > form > div.buttons > input[disabled="disabled"]:active{background-image:-webkit-linear-gradient(top, #FFF 0,#EEE 100%);background-image:-moz-linear-gradient(top, #FFF 0,#EEE 100%);background-image:-o-linear-gradient(top, #FFF 0,#EEE 100%);background-image:-ms-linear-gradient(top, #FFF 0,#EEE 100%);background-image:linear-gradient(top, #FFF 0,#EEE 100%);color:#CCC;border-color:#DDD;}@media screen and (max-width:599px){div.contact > div.inner > div.column:nth-child(1),div.contact > div.inner > div.column:nth-child(2){width:calc(100% - 20px);float:none;margin:0 auto 0 auto;padding:20px 0 0 0;}}